柯林斯词典
- N-UNCOUNT 文化,文明(如艺术、哲学)
Cultureconsists of activities such as the arts and philosophy, which are considered to be important for the development of civilization and of people's minds.- There is just not enough fun and frivolity in culture today.
当今的文化恰恰是不够轻松有趣。 - ...aspects of popular culture.
大众文化的方方面面 - ...France's Minister of Culture and Education.
法国文化和教育部部长

- N-COUNT 文化(尤指拥有特定信仰、生活方式或艺术形式的社会或文明)
Acultureis a particular society or civilization, especially considered in relation to its beliefs, way of life, or art.- ...people from different cultures...
来自不同文化背景的人们 - I was brought up in a culture that said you must put back into the society what you have taken out.
我成长于其中的那个社会文化认为,取之社会必须回报社会。

- N-COUNT 文化(某组织或群体的一致习惯和行为方式)
Thecultureof a particular organization or group consists of the habits of the people in it and the way they generally behave.- But social workers say that this has created a culture of dependency, particularly in urban areas...
然而社会工作者认为这使得人们普遍产生了依赖,尤其是在城市地区。 - The institutions have realised they need to change their culture to improve efficiency and service.
这些机构已经意识到需要改变他们的内部文化以提高效率、改进服务。

- N-COUNT 培养物;培养菌;培养细胞
In science, acultureis a group of bacteria or cells which are grown, usually in a laboratory as part of an experiment.- ...a culture of human cells.
人类细胞的培养物 - ...a number of tissue culture experiments.
多次组织细胞培养实验

- VERB 培养(细菌);培植(细胞)
In science, toculturea group of bacteria or cells means to grow them, usually in a laboratory as part of an experiment.- To confirm the diagnosis, the hospital laboratory must culture a colony of bacteria.
为进一步确诊,医院实验室必须培养一个细菌菌落。 - ...cultured human blood cells.
培养的人体血细胞
